bait |
food used to attract and catch fish or animals. |
builder |
a person who puts things together to make something, especially houses or other structures that people live or work in. |
cab |
a short form of taxicab. |
cane |
a stick made of metal or wood that helps someone walk. |
case2 |
a container for holding, carrying, or keeping things safe. |
cheer |
happy or good feelings. |
curl |
to make into a curved shape. |
music |
pleasant sounds made by voices or instruments. |
pavement |
the hard surface on a road or other flat area. |
pool |
any small still area of liquid that has collected on something. |
proud |
feeling pleased and satisfied because of something one owns or has done. |
quite |
completely. |
secret |
not seen or known by others; private. |
silk |
a fine, soft, shiny fiber produced by certain insects. |
tag |
a piece of thick paper, thin metal, or plastic that gives information and is attached to something. |
